King Kamehameha IV put Niihau up for sale in 1863, and Kauai resident Elizabeth Sinclair bought the island for $10,000 (she reportedly chose to purchase Niihau over a few other pieces of real estate, including Waikiki and Pearl Harbor). The Seattle restaurant community was stunned last week when Elizabeth Mar, 72, the well-known owner of popular Hawaiian mainstay, Kona Kitchen, died from COVID-19.In a heartbreaking turn, her husband Robert, 78, died just a day later of the same disease.They would have celebrated their 50th wedding anniversary this coming August. Niihau’s transition to the “Forbidden Island” began in 1864 when Scottish widower Elizabeth McHutchison Sinclair purchased the island from Hawaiian monarch, King Kamehameha IV, for $10,000 in gold, for ranching purposes. In 1864, Elizabeth Sinclair-Robinson, born in Scotland and a plantation owner in New Zealand, purchased the island of Ni‘ihau from King Kamehameha V and the Kingdom of Hawaii for $10,000.With this exchange, she promised to preserve the “kahiki” or native Hawaiian culture.
